Which is cheaper, Waukesha County Technical College or Blackhawk Technical College?

Blackhawk Technical College, at $9,330 a year after aid versus $11,101 — a gap of $1,771 a year, or $7,084 across the full degree. These are net prices after grants and scholarships, not sticker prices, so they reflect what an aided student pays.

Do Waukesha County Technical College or Blackhawk Technical College graduates earn more?

Waukesha County Technical College graduates report a median $46,894 ten years after entry, $5,274 more than the $41,620 at Blackhawk Technical College. Both are institution-wide medians from federal tax records, so a high-paying major at the lower school can beat the average at the higher one.

Which leaves students with less debt, Waukesha County Technical College or Blackhawk Technical College?

Blackhawk Technical College: its completers carry a median $9,550 in federal loans versus $12,000 at Waukesha County Technical College, a difference of $2,450. The figure counts students who finished; it excludes private loans and anyone who left before graduating.

Which graduates more of its students?

44% of students finish at Waukesha County Technical College, against 34% at Blackhawk Technical College. Completion matters to the ROI arithmetic because a degree that is never finished still carries its cost and its debt, but earns none of the graduate premium above the $48,360 high-school baseline.
